About The Thatched Cottage
The Thatched Cottage is a four-bedroom detached house in East Mersea, Colchester, Colchester (CO5 8UJ). It has a recorded floor area of 205 m² (around 2207 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(April 2015)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in July 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from April 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include notable views and a self-contained annexe. Period features are noted in the property record.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2003.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2001–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Sold June 2021 for £635,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
